Adding Plating to Sparks?
Is it possible to add plating to Sparks in the ini? I see where I can add armor ( [SparkSoldier X2SparkCharacterTemplate_DLC_3] in xcomgamedata_characterstats.ini at least i think) but that may be too powerful early on.

Re: Adding Plating to Sparks?
the stat you're looking for is eStat_ShieldHP, you can try to add it the same way you add armor:
CharacterBaseStats[eStat_ShieldHP]=X
Where X is however much you want to add. From the change log, the next release will add that too, so you can modify the added value if you want.

Re: Adding Plating to Sparks?
Unfortunately, this doesn't regenerate between missions.Sentenryu wrote:the stat you're looking for is eStat_ShieldHP, you can try to add it the same way you add armor:
CharacterBaseStats[eStat_ShieldHP]=X
Where X is however much you want to add. From the change log, the next release will add that too, so you can modify the added value if you want.
The fix in 1.1 adds the points in an ability attached to their armor, iirc.
